CVE-2023-41848
CVE-2023-41848 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Majeedraza Carousel Slider with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.3.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-862.

Description
Missing Authorization vulnerability in Majeed Raza Carousel Slider allows Exploiting Incorrectly Configured Access Control Security Levels.This issue affects Carousel Slider: from n/a through 2.2.2.

- How severe is CVE-2023-41848?
- CVE-2023-41848 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.3,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ity low, and availability none.
